The Anilam Xbarandcable is a device used in industrial electronics to interface with machine tools and equipment. Its primary purpose is to provide communication between the machine's control unit and external devices through ports such as RS-232. The device features robust construction, reliable data transmission capabilities, and easy integration with various industrial equipment. Typical failures in the Anilam Xbarandcable include connector issues, cable damage, and electronic component failures due to wear and tear. Regular maintenance and inspection are recommended to ensure optimal performance and prevent downtime.

The Anilam A30250 is an industrial electronic component specifically designed for controlling spindle drives in manufacturing machinery. Its primary purpose is to modulate and regulate the speed and rotation of the spindle motor to ensure precise and accurate machining operations. The Anilam A30250 is equipped with various features such as programmable speed settings, feedback loop control, and fault detection mechanisms for optimal performance. Common failures in the Anilam A30250 can include issues with the control circuitry, power supply failures, overheating of components, or faults in the feedback loop system. These failures can lead to erratic spindle speeds, inaccurate machining results, or complete breakdown of the spindle drive functionality. Proper maintenance and periodic checks are recommended to prevent such failures and ensure the smooth operation of the Anilam A30250 in industrial settings.

The Anilam 3000M controller is a crucial industrial electronic component used in machine tool applications to regulate and control various machining operations. It features a user-friendly interface with advanced functions such as spindle speed control, axis positioning, and tool change management. Common failures with the Anilam 3000M controller include power supply issues, control panel malfunctions, software glitches, and connectivity problems. These failures can lead to inaccurate positioning, erratic machine behavior, and production downtime. Regular maintenance and timely troubleshooting are recommended to ensure optimal performance and efficiency of the controller.
